EXIN, the global independent certification institute for ICT professionals, has signed an agreement with HP to develop a certification program for OpenStack™, the open source cloud operating system that is already used by many organizations worldwide, with support from HP. HP will be first to offer the opportunity to gain certification through the training course, which will be based upon the established HP OpenStack course.

OpenStack is an open source cloud operating system that controls large pools of compute, storage and networking resources throughout a datacenter, all managed through a dashboard that gives administrators control while empowering users to provision resources through a web interface…
